The New York Times on Monday published what it described as a “missing chapter” of the Democratic National Committee’s widely criticized “autopsy” of the 2024 presidential election.

The chapter, titled “What Happened in 2024” and provided to the Times by Democratic strategist Paul Rivera, offers criticisms of party consultants who are “self-enriching” and out of touch with the concerns of ordinary voters.

Specifically, the chapter questions whether Democratic politicians and operatives have a grasp on the economic realities facing most Americans, while calling for “a fundamental re-evaluation” of whether Democrats “really understand the wants and needs of voters.”

“An emerging critique of Democratic decision-making,” the chapter states, “is there are too many people who have become generationally wealthy off politics and drive too much of the decision-making within the ecosystem. This is deeply frustrating to many… who want to try a different set of politics but keep banging their heads up against a system proven to be inflexible and self-enriching.”

The chapter adds that “many of the people who worked at the highest levels of the party” are “financially secure,” and thus potentially insulated “from the realities many Americans were encountering in their lives.”

Democrats trying to lay policy groundwork for the 2028 presidential race are rolling out their first major policy proposal: a framework for online child safety.

Known as “Project 2029,” the liberal group was formed as a counterweight to the conservative Project 2025 to write a policy agenda for the next Democratic presidential nominee. The group reckons starting with online internet safety — which has widespread Democratic support — will help galvanize the party to address what it calls this generation’s “tobacco moment.”

The “Kids Over Clicks” proposal calls for narrowing protections under Section 230 of the Communications Decency Act that shield platforms from some liability. Among other items, the group wants to clarify that companies aren’t protected from lawsuits stemming from AI-generated content, paid ads, illegal content or activity, and platforms that promote stalking or other nonconsensual behavior.

The group is hoping the plans will pick up traction among what is expected to be a crowded field of Democratic presidential candidates heading into 2028.

“We’re going to see many people running for president … and we want to set the standard in terms of the type of ambition that we want to see when it comes to solving these problems,” said Chad Maisel, a former adviser to President Joe Biden and Democratic Sen. Cory Booker who now serves as Project 2029’s executive director.

The proposal also advocates for banning social media accounts for kids under 16 years old, adopting stronger default privacy protections, designing safer internet platforms, banning cell phones in schools (with exceptions), pushing for a smartphone-free childhood until age 14, banning surveillance advertising, and limiting data collection on children.

Project 2029 wanted to start with kids safety because it’s among the least politically polarizing topics, but plans to release policy agendas centered on issues including healthcare, housing, AI, and the border.

Add Pod Save America co-host and former Obama official Dan Pfeiffer to the list of those warning mainstream Democrats about a surge from the left. On the podcast, the former Obama communications director framed a string of progressive primary wins—from New York to Maine to California—as a “giant warning sign” for the party establishment, reports Mediaite. Candidates from groups on the party’s left flank are outworking and out-maneuvering more traditional candidates, “and if you are someone in the Democratic establishment, you should be deeply concerned about what this says about where the party is, what the standing of the party is, what the ability of the party infrastructure actually is to win elections,” said Pfeiffer. “So this is a big deal.”

The issue continues to generate conversation in political circles:

  • The next big test is Tuesday in Colorado, reports CNN. Melat Kiros, a 29-year-old democratic socialist and attorney, is challenging longtime Democratic Rep. Diana DeGette for a reliably blue seat in Denver. “I think voters have realized that the party and leadership are failing to meet this moment in a meaningful way, and it’s time for leaders who are actually going to be fighting for the interests of working people,” she tells the outlet.
  • Over the weekend, New York City Mayor framed the wins of three democratic socialists in congressional primaries there as a “national message” about how ordinary Americans are getting worn down by higher costs.
  • Last week, 15 House Democratic centrists fired back, issuing a public letter asserting that “we are capitalist, not socialist,” per the New York Times.
  • In his critique, Pfeiffer added that, at this point, an endorsement from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er or House Minority Leader Hakeem Jeffries might hurt more than help a Democratic candidate.
  • President Trump is rolling out a midterm message for Republicans that “communists” are taking over the Democratic Party, per Axios. He’s going after the likely next mayor of DC, Janeese Lewis George, in particular, notes the Hill.

Examining their last presidential election loss and looking ahead to 2028, Democrats are divided on whether the issue is that their candidates aren’t succeeding in selling voters on the party’s policies or the problem is the ideas themselves. So they plan to put together a book of Democratic stances, with a new section released every quarter, for candidates to work with in the next primaries, the New York Times reports. Project 2029 is modeled after the right-wing agenda President Trump disavowed as a candidate and put into action once in office, though not by name.

Party operatives aren’t concerned that their attacks on Project 2025 will rebound on them. They just need to tell a compelling story. In the 2024 campaign, “we didn’t lack policies,” said Celinda Lake, a Democratic pollster. “But we lacked a functioning narrative to communicate those policies.” She said her party’s candidates hit voters with “agencies and acronyms and statistics” rather than with a clear story about “what we’re going to fight for.” Installments in Project 2029 will be released quarterly in Democracy: A Journal of Ideas.

But it’s not just the format that Democrats can take a lesson from, said a former aide in Democratic White Houses who’s on the project’s advisory board. “Liberals underestimate the power of Trump’s ideas,” said Neera Tanden, adding that her party needs better ones to compete. “We get wrapped up in his personality. But he puts forward an idea like ‘No tax on tips,’ and that’s an important signifier that he is championing working-class people,” she added. The project has Democratic skeptics. “Developing policies by checking every coalitional box is how we got in this mess in the first place,” said Adam Jentleson, who’s mulling launching a new think tank.

Dozen of advocacy organizations on Wednesday joined the growing call for U.S.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er to step down from his leadership position after caving to Republicans on a stopgap spending measure last month.

Given GOP control of Congress and the White House, people across the country saw the looming government shutdown as a rare opportunity for Democratic lawmakers to fight against President Donald Trump’s agenda. However, Schumer (D-N.Y.) led 10 caucus members in partnering with Senate Republicans to force through the spending legislation.

Since then, polling has made clear that voters are frustrated with the Democratic Party and Schumer in particular, and want political leaders to challenge the GOP’s agenda, which is primarily passing more tax giveaways for the wealthy and gutting the federal government—an effort led by Trump adviser Elon Musk, the richest person on Earth.

“Schumer’s inexplicable surrender and support for a dangerous and cruel MAGA spending bill amounted to a complete dereliction of duty and failure of leadership. For this simple reason, Schumer must step down as Senate majority leader immediately,” added Jones, whose group led the letter with Progressive Democrats of America (PDA) and the Center for Biological Diversity (CBD).

A poll released Friday from the progressive think tank Data for Progress has Democratic Rep.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ez besting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er, also a Democrat, by 19 points in a hypothetical matchup in the 2028 New York primary for a U.S. Senate seat.

According to the poll, which was was first shared exclusively with Politico, 55% of voters said they would cast a ballot for Ocasio-Cortez or leaned toward supporting her, and 36% said they would support Schumer or leaned toward supporting him, with 9% undecided.

The only subgroup that supported Schumer over Ocasio-Cortez were moderates, who favored Schumer 50%-35%, with 15% undecided. Ocasio-Cortez carried all other subgroups with an outright majority, except for voters over the age of 45, 49% of whom said they would support her or leaned toward supporting her.

The poll—while several years out from the actual race—comes in the wake of Schumer’s decision to throw his support behind a Republican-backed spending bill in early March, a move that roiled his own party and prompted calls for him to step aside from his leadership position in the Senate.
